Common Methods of Alcohol Testing

  • Breathalyzer
  • Blood test
  • Saliva test
  • Urine test
  • Sweat patch

Breathalyzer - Used for quick, on-the-spot testing, especially in law enforcement.
Blood test - Provides precise measurements, often used in medical settings.
Saliva test - Offers a non-invasive option with moderate detection windows.
Urine test - More common in workplace testing due to cost-effectiveness.
Sweat patch - Used for continuous monitoring over a set period.

Fingernail Drug Testing Services

Nail drug testing in Jamieson, Florida examines keratinized nail samples to determine chronic drug use. By detecting long-term drug history, it offers an incredibly reliable method that resists contamination. This unique testing option is critical for comprehensive substance abuse evaluations. Learn More

What is the Detection Window for Fingernail Drug Tests

  • Fingernails: Reflects up to 6 months of usage
  • Toenails: Captures up to a year’s drug history

Common Types of Occupational Health Tests

  • Fitness for duty exams: Evaluates physical capability for tasks.
  • Respirator Fit Testing: Ensures proper fit for respiratory protection.
  • Pulmonary Function Tests (PFT's): Assesses lung efficiency.
  • Tuberculosis (TB): Screens for infectious diseases.
  • Vision: Checks visual capability, essential for certain roles.
  • Audiometric: Tests hearing abilities.

If an initial screen is not negative, the sample goes through confirmatory testing using more specific analytical methods. Final results are not reported until confirmation is complete to ensure accuracy and defensibility.
Yes. Accredited Drug Testing offers on-site/mobile collections for employers. Mobile collections reduce employee downtime, are useful for job sites and remote work locations, and are critical for immediate post-incident or reasonable suspicion situations.
Common specimen types include urine, hair, saliva/oral fluid, and breath (for alcohol). Each method supports different needs: urine is widely used for workplace testing, hair provides a longer detection history, saliva/oral fluid can capture more recent use, and breath alcohol testing measures current alcohol concentration.
